How do I get my security license in Missouri?
Armed Security Guard Requirements in Missouri
The applicant must be a U.S. citizen or a registered resident alien. The applicant must successfully pass a background check that may include drug testing. The applicant must have a Missouri state driver’s license. The applicant must be in good physical condition.

How old do you have to be to be a security guard in Missouri?
Licenses are issued as armed or unarmed. The minimum age is 18 for unarmed guards, 21 for armed guards. Licenses may be denied on the basis of felony convictions (if from the prior ten years) or of certain misdemeanor convictions (if from the prior five years).

Are there more private security than police?
It is estimated that, worldwide, more persons are employed as private security officers than as police officers (van Dijk, cited in Prenzler, 2012:151). This phenomenon has been described as “one of the most significant developments since World War II” (Prenzler, 2013:9).
What is the demand for private security?
US demand for private contracted security services is projected to expand 4.2 percent per year through 2019 to $66.9 billion. Gains will be supported by the real and perceived risk of crime and by accelerating economic activity, particularly as new businesses form and create new users of security services.

Can a felon be a security guard in California?
What if I have a felony or misdemeanor conviction? Crimes of violence and felonies automatically disqualify you from applying to be a security guard in the State of California. For all others, the State considers the circumstances surrounding your conviction and evidence of rehabilitation.

What is difference between security guard and security officer?
‘Security guard’ is sometimes used to denote a watchperson who occupies a particular post or patrols a limit area but exercises little independent judgment. ‘Security officer’ may be used to denote a professional who has a wider range of duties and exercises more independent judgment.
What industry is private security?
The security services industry consists of companies who provide private security guards and patrol vehicles, as well as additional ancillary services such as alarm systems, cyber security, background screening, investigation, risk analysis, and security consultancy services.
Is private security a growing field?
Job Outlook
Overall employment of security guards and gambling surveillance officers is projected to grow 15 percent from 2020 to 2030, faster than the average for all occupations. About 165,000 openings for security guards and gambling surveillance officers are projected each year, on average, over the decade.

Can store security handcuff you?
However, a store security guard may never apply excessive force when detaining or physically restraining a suspected shoplifter. Excessive force may include beating, choking, and/or using handcuffs or cable ties in a way that is considered to be unlawful or improper.

Can a male door supervisor search a female?
It is permissible in such cases for male door supervisors to search female patrons (and vice versa), but these searches must never be physical in nature. A female customer may turn out her pockets or empty a handbag at the request of a male door supervisor, but she must not be touched.
